视频通话API如何实现视频监控功能?

随着互联网技术的不断发展,视频通话API已经成为现代通信领域的重要工具。除了实现传统的语音通话功能外,视频监控功能也成为了视频通话API的一个重要应用场景。本文将详细介绍视频通话API如何实现视频监控功能。

一、视频监控功能概述

视频监控功能指的是通过视频通话API实现实时视频监控,对监控区域进行实时观察、记录和报警等功能。该功能广泛应用于家庭、企业、公共场所等领域,具有很高的实用价值。

二、视频监控功能实现原理

  1. 硬件设备

实现视频监控功能需要以下硬件设备:

(1)摄像头:用于采集监控区域的视频画面。

(2)网络设备:如路由器、交换机等,用于传输视频数据。

(3)存储设备:如硬盘、U盘等,用于存储视频数据。


  1. 软件平台

实现视频监控功能需要以下软件平台:

(1)视频通话API:提供视频采集、传输、解码等功能的接口。

(2)视频监控平台:负责监控视频数据的接收、处理、存储和报警等功能。


  1. 实现步骤

(1)摄像头采集视频画面:摄像头将监控区域的视频画面转换为数字信号。

(2)网络传输:通过视频通话API将数字信号传输到监控平台。

(3)解码:监控平台对接收到的数字信号进行解码,恢复视频画面。

(4)存储:将解码后的视频画面存储到存储设备中。

(5)报警:当监控区域发生异常情况时,监控平台根据预设规则进行报警。

三、视频监控功能实现技术

  1. 视频采集技术

视频采集技术是视频监控功能实现的基础。目前,常见的视频采集技术有:

(1)模拟视频采集:通过摄像头采集模拟信号,然后转换为数字信号。

(2)数字视频采集:直接采集数字信号,无需转换。


  1. 视频传输技术

视频传输技术是实现视频监控功能的关键。目前,常见的视频传输技术有:

(1)有线传输:通过网线、光纤等有线方式进行传输。

(2)无线传输:通过Wi-Fi、4G/5G等无线方式进行传输。


  1. 视频解码技术

视频解码技术是将传输的视频数据进行解码,恢复视频画面的过程。常见的视频解码技术有:

(1)H.264:一种国际标准视频压缩编码技术,具有高效、低延迟等特点。

(2)H.265:H.264的升级版,具有更高的压缩比和更好的画质。


  1. 视频存储技术

视频存储技术是实现视频监控功能的数据保障。常见的视频存储技术有:

(1)硬盘存储:使用硬盘作为存储介质,具有成本低、容量大等特点。

(2)云存储:将视频数据存储在云端,具有高可靠性、易扩展等特点。

四、视频监控功能在实际应用中的优势

  1. 实时性:视频监控功能可以实现实时视频监控,及时发现异常情况。

  2. 可视化:通过视频画面,用户可以直观地了解监控区域的状况。

  3. 便捷性:用户可以通过手机、电脑等设备随时随地查看监控画面。

  4. 高效性:视频监控功能可以大大提高工作效率,降低人力成本。

  5. 安全性:视频监控功能有助于提高安全防范能力,预防犯罪行为。

总之,视频通话API实现视频监控功能具有广泛的应用前景。随着技术的不断发展,视频监控功能将更加完善,为人们的生活和工作带来更多便利。

猜你喜欢:环信聊天工具